Program Description

The Social Service Worker – Gerontology program at Sheridan College prepares students to work with older adults in various community and healthcare settings. The curriculum focuses on the physical, emotional, and social aspects of aging, equipping students with the knowledge and skills needed to support the well-being of seniors. Key topics include geriatric care, mental health, advocacy, and elder abuse prevention. Students also learn about social policies affecting older adults and the importance of cultural competence in gerontological practice. Practical experience is gained through field placements in senior centers, long-term care facilities, and community organizations. Graduates are prepared to pursue careers as gerontology workers, case managers, and program coordinators, contributing to the enhancement of quality of life for older adults.

Admission Requirements

To be eligible for this program, you must meet the following academic standards. These requirements ensure you have the necessary foundation to succeed in your studies.

1. Academic Qualification (Must meet ONE of the following):

  • High School Graduate: You must have completed Grade 12 with an overall score of 50% or higher.

    • OR

  • Diploma Holder: You can also apply if you have completed a 3-year Diploma after Grade 10 (often called a "10+3" diploma) from a recognized institution, with an overall score of 50% or higher.

2. Required Subject:

  • English Proficiency: You must have a passing grade in Grade 12 English (ENG4C or ENG4U level, or the equivalent in your country). This is mandatory to ensure you can handle the reading and writing required in the course.

Career Opportunities

Here are the common career options and job titles for graduates of a Social Service Worker - Gerontology program, broken down by role and work setting.

  • Social Service Worker (Gerontology Specialist): assessing the needs of older adults and connecting them with government or community resources.

  • Case Manager / Case Worker: Creating and managing care plans for seniors who need medical, financial, or social assistance.

  • Activation Coordinator / Life Enrichment Aide: Designing and running recreational, social, and fitness programs in retirement homes to keep seniors active and engaged.

  • Family Support Worker: Acting as a liaison between seniors and their families, often helping navigate difficult transitions like moving into care.

  • Outreach Worker: Visiting isolated seniors in their own homes to check on their well-being and deliver services.

  • Palliative / Hospice Care Support: Providing emotional and social support to individuals and families during end-of-life care.
